  2. Firefox Tip, transferring profiles from a old pc

    If you are coming from a old pc and need to transfer your old profiles try this.

    Go to your old pc

    Press Windows + R to open the run command

    type%appdata%

    Go to the mozilla folder

    Click Firefox

    and Profiles

    Copy the folder(s) if you have more than one folder

    Make a folder on the desktop. Paste on Desktop in the folder for example using control v


    To add those profiles to a new pc

    Paste the profiles you copied from the old pc on a thumb drive/external hard drive

    Once that is done

    Install firefox as normal

    To transfer the new profiles do these steps

    There's many different methods but this easier

    Press Windows + R to open the run command

    Type firefox (or firefox.exe) -p

    You see choose user profile

    There is a default folder. Leave this be
    Click create profile
    Make a name if you want
    Click choose folder
    There should be the default folder only
    Find the folder you created on the desktop
    And paste it in that folder
    Once complete, you see all data intact. You may have to key in the passwords again on newer firefox.
